Kit Contains:
Apogee Electronics Symphony Studio 2x12 USB-C Audio Interface
Legendary Apogee Conversion for Mixing and Mastering Engineers
Ideal for producers and mixing, mastering, postproduction engineers working in professional studios, the Apogee Electronics Symphony Studio 2x12 is a 2-in / 12-out USB-C Audio Interface that offers legendary Apogee conversion, input DSP for recording with effects, Room EQ and Bass Management, and up to 7.1.4 Atmos immersive mixing. The interface provides extensive I/O for studio setups, including two highly transparent mic/line preamp inputs (via XLR) and twelve line outputs via two DB-25 connectors.

The Studio 2x12sports converters from the flagship Symphony Mk II interfaces, providing up to 24-bit / 192 kHz high-fidelity conversion. The highly transparent mic preamps deliver 75 dB of ultraclean gain. There are also two independent, zero-ohm headphone outputs. The Studio 2x12 features a USB-C port for plug-and-play host connections with both macOS and Windows computers. And with a deep extruded aluminum faceplate, the interface provides a stylish and look that will fit into any studio environment and stand the test of time.

RODE NT1 5th Generation Large-Diaphragm Cardioid Condenser XLR/USB Microphone (Black)
An NT1 with XLR and USB for Recording, Podcasting, and Streaming
Featuring both an analog XLR connector and a digital USB-C connector, the black Rode NT1 5th Generation represents another major leap forward for this highly regarded large-diaphragm workhorse microphone. The dual connection options offer a new level of flexibility, allowing users without an audio interface to plug directly into the computer for recording, podcasting, and streaming duties courtesy of the onboard 32-bit floating point A to D converter. Of course, if you have an audio interface, podcasting station, or favorite microphone preamp, no problem—just connect the mic's XLR output to your analog equipment and you're good to go. Combining a true-condenser capsule, ultralow-noise circuitry, and an extremely durable housing, the Rode NT1 5th Generation large-diaphragm cardioid microphone is well suited for high-resolution digital recording of vocal and instrument sources at home, in the studio, or even onstage.
Internally Shockmounted HF6 Cardioid Condenser Capsule
  • Behind the protective mesh grille, the mic features Rode's 1" gold-sputtered HF6 capsule, designed to provide a detailed midrange response with smooth highs and warm bass.
  • The cardioid polar pattern focuses audio capture on the souce in front of the mic, picking up less unwanted ambient sound from the back and sides.
  • The transducer itself is suspended inside the microphone using Rycote's industry-leading Lyre system, minimizing external vibrations at the capsule level. The capsule is then married to high-grade electronics that have been designed to provide an extremely low noise level. The NT1 5th Gen is an incredibly quiet microphone, measuring only 4 dBA of self-noise.
  • The mic is powered by phantom power through the XLR connector or by bus power through the USB-C port.
Revolution Preamp and 32-Bit Floating Point Converters
  • Rode has equipped the digital side of the NT1 5th Gen with some innovative features to ensure you get outstanding audio quality from the USB connection, beginning with the built-in Revolution preamp which provides plenty of ultralow-noise gain to feed the analog to digital converter.
  • With its 32-bit floating point A to D converter, you'll never need to worry about clipping again. The converter supplies supplies such a high headroom and wide dynamic range that its virtually impossible to overload, allowing you to worry less about maintaining perfect recording levels and focus more on your creative work.
  • Sampling rates of up to 192 kHz are supported.
Bundled Accessories
  • The NT1 5th Generation is supplied with the SM6, a studio-grade suspension shockmount that provides isolation from external physical factors that may cause unwanted rumble and vibrations in the microphone.
  • The SM6 includes a removable pop shield with two axes of adjustment and a telescopic arm for ultimate application versatility.
  • The mic also comes with a balanced XLR microphone cable and a USB-C to USB-C cable.
  • A carrying pouch is also supplied.
